Liz Truss and Kwasi Kwarteng have abandoned a plan to abolish the 45p rate of income tax, just 10 days after it was announced in the mini-budget.

So it wasn't the right thing to do at this moment in time," he told ITV News. The abolition of the 45pc rate had become a distraction from our mission to get Britain moving. Many felt that spending around £2 billion annually on a tax cut for top earners while scrapping the cap on bankers’ bonuses was seen as politically toxic while millions face the squeeze of the cost-of-living crisis. Higher earners will lose thousands of pounds in tax savings after the Chancellor abandoned plans to abolish the top rate of income tax next year.

The policy was originally announced less than two weeks ago in the mini-Budget, alongside proposals to introduce a 1p cut to the basic rate of income tax in April.
